#### Disable Container Insights

To disable container insights for the ECS cluster execute following command.

```
```bash
aws ecs update-cluster-settings --cluster ${clustername} --settings name=containerInsights,value=disabled --region ${AWS_REGION}
```

Your output should look similar to this one below.
